Going for simulation and planning this morning. Had to prepare this weekend by taking recommended laxative both nights. They need bowels empty. Bladder needs to be emptied 45 mins before appointment and then within next 15 minutes drink 500ml of water and hold until session is over. I believe they will be marking an X on the places they will aim when the real thing starts next week.

Thanks to everyone.. Simulation went well except that the laxative they gave me didn't quite do the job. I got sent to the loo to see if I could work it out....nearly popped a blood vessel but I managed....Whew! Big Grin They say it puts pressure on the bladder and they don't want that. I have three permanent dots (tattoos) on me now. I believe they use these to hit the target. One on each hip and one just above the privates. The CT scan pinpoints where to aim and where to put the tats. However I've been told to wait two more weeks before I start radiation. At that time I'll get a schedule (20 sessions over 4 weeks).
